What Are Singing Sand Dunes?
Singing sand dunes are large accumulations of sand that produce sounds when disturbed, such as by footsteps, wind, or avalanches. The sounds range from low-frequency rumbles to high-pitched whistles, depending on the size and composition of the dunes. The most famous examples are found in places like the dunes of the Badain Jaran Desert in China, the Gobi Desert in Mongolia, and even parts of the Mojave Desert in the United States.

The Cultural Significance of Singing Dunes
Throughout history, singing sand dunes have captivated the imaginations of those who encounter them. Indigenous communities and travelers have long attributed mystical or spiritual significance to these natural wonders. For example, some cultures believed that the sounds were the voices of ancient spirits or guardians of the desert. In modern times, singing dunes have become a source of scientific curiosity and tourist attraction, drawing visitors from around the world to experience their mysterious melodies.
